Managing Consultant, Environmental Permitting Specialist

ERM is the largest global pure play sustainability consultancy, partnering with leading organizations to create innovative solutions to sustainability challenges. The Managing Consultant, Environmental Permitting Specialist will lead transformative environmental projects in New Jersey, driving business development and managing complex permitting projects while mentoring a high-performing technical team.

Responsibilities

Lead Growth: Develop and implement strategic plans to expand ERM’s IAP services in New Jersey
Seller/Doer Role: Identify opportunities, craft winning proposals, and deliver exceptional consulting services
Technical Leadership: Oversee DLRP permitting efforts, ensuring compliance and quality across projects
Team Development: Hire, mentor, and inspire a talented technical team to achieve excellence
Client Engagement: Deepen relationships with existing clients and establish new partnerships for long-term success
Global Collaboration: Work with ERM’s worldwide network to share best practices and deliver integrated solutions

Qualification

Environmental permittingImpact assessmentBusiness developmentConsulting experienceClient relationship managementTechnical team leadershipProfessional certificationsRenewable energy projectsLarge-scale capital expansions

Required

BS/MS in environmental studies, natural resources, planning, geography, civil/environmental engineering, or related field
4+ years of consulting experience with NJDEP DLRP and multi-media permitting
Proven ability to develop and execute business growth strategies in New Jersey
Established relationships with electric and gas utilities and NJDEP DLRP staff
Strong technical expertise in environmental permitting and impact assessment
Demonstrated success in client relationship management and generating repeat business
This position is not eligible for immigration sponsorship

Preferred

Professional certifications such as PWS, PE, CEP, AICP
Recognized marketplace reputation and positive standing with key regulators
Experience with renewable energy projects and large-scale capital expansions
